Windcorp Brass Band

Windcorp Brass Band was established in Gothenburg in January 2005 by Andreas Kratz and Anders Hellman and is made up of professional musicians, music pedagogues and skilful amateurs with one common denominator – the wish to play brass band at a high musical level. The home base is Gothenburg on the Swedish west coast but the band members are located all over south and middle Sweden.

In spite of its short history the band has already made an impression on the international brass band scene. Being reigning Swedish Champions they have appeared with highly esteemed conductors and artists like Garry E Cutt, Michel Becquet, Chris Houlding, Mogens Andresen, Stefan Schulz (Berliner Philharmoniker), Øystein Baadsvik and Tomas Lind (Tenor-Gothenburg Opera House).

The cooperation between the band and its Professional Conductor Alexander Hanson has been fantastic from the first moment. It was therefore absolutely natural that Alexander Hanson during 2006 was appointed the band’s first Musical Director. It is without doubt his wonderful talent and pleasant attitude that has made Windcorp Brass Band as successful as it is.

On the contest scene the band’s greatest success is the win of the elite section at the International Grenland Brass Band Festival in May 2008.

On that occasion experienced conductor Mr Garry E Cutt was in front of the band.

Musical Director

Alexander Hanson was born in Södertälje 1974. He is raised within the Salvation Army and started playing the cornet in the Södertälje Band of the Salvation Army at an early age. Eventually he succeeded his father Torgny as bandmaster for this band – a position he held for six years.

Alexander Hanson started his professional musical career as trumpet player, educated at the Royal Academy of Music in Stockholm, but soon took interest in the art of conducting. He began his academic conducting education at the Royal Academy of Music in Stockholm in 2000, but soon transferred to the world famous Sibelius Academy in Helsinki where he studied under Professor Leif Segerstam. Also, Jorma Panula and Atso Almila has been one of Alexander Hansons teachers outside the Sibelius Academy. Alexander Hanson concluded his conducting education in October 2004 by performing among other items Edvard Elgar’s “Enigma Variations” with the Helsingborg Symphony Orchestra.

Today he works frequently with ensembles like Royal Stockholm Philharmonic Orchestra, Swedish Radio Symphony Orchestra, The Royal Opera Orchestra, Malmö Symphony Orchestra, Norrköping Symphony Orchestra, Helsingborg Symphony Orchestra, Gävle Symphony Orchestra, Gothenburg Symphony Orchestra, Trondheim Symphony Orchestra, Dala Sinfoniettan, Västerås Sinfonietta and Nordic Chamber Orchestra. His opera engagements also included several productions - Mozart’s “Cosi fan tutte”and Rossini’s “The Barber of Seville” and Donizetti’s “L'Elisir d'Amore”.

Alexander Hanson has during his career cooperated with prominent soloists like Christian Lindberg, Henning Kraggerud, Torleif Thedéen, Martin Fröst, Nils Landgren, Anders Paulsson, Martin Sturfält, Martina Dike, Anna Larsson, Sara Trobäck, Claes Gunnarsson, Kroumata, Per Enokson, Lill Lindfors, Vilde Frang Bjærke, Karl-Magnus Fredriksson, Stefan Schulz and Michel Becquet.

From January 2005 Alexander Hanson is the Artistic Director and Chief Conductor of the famous Göteborg Wind Orchestra.
